School Board Member Karen Gresham Vies to Help Democrats Get a State House Majority in Battleground LD Four

If Arizona Democrats take both houses of the State Legislature in 2026, they would probably accomplish it by taking the House and Senate seats in Legislative District (LD) Four, located in Northern Phoenix and Scottsdale.
